On a right hand bend you stay left or at least left of centre of the lane and lean the bike to get it to turn, shift your weight on the bike to the right side to help it turn and do some counter steering, even just move your torso to the right side towards the right bar if nothing else to get the bike to turn, but the line this guy in front of you has chosen is just crazy because he doesn't know how to ride a bike. He clearly hasn't shifted any of his weight, still sat bolt up right with arms dead straight on the bars. Not good.
